Attomolar to Micromolar Conversion Formula
One Attomolar is equal to 1e-12 Micromolar.
Formula: 1 aM = 1e-12 μM

What is Molar Concentration?
Molar concentration (also called molarity) expresses the amount of a solute dissolved per unit volume of solution. Its SI unit is mol/m³, but the most widely used practical unit is mol/L (moles per litre), also written as M or mol·L⁻¹. For example, a 1 M (one molar) solution of sodium chloride contains 1 mole of NaCl dissolved in enough water to make 1 litre of solution. Molar concentration is the primary way of expressing solution strength in chemistry, biology, and medicine.
